C/C++高手的选择 (2)

原创 2007年10月12日 16:13:00

 mishier395朋友不相信APR的神奇,让我举一个例子。好,下面我们拿一个搜索引擎说一下:

Lucene4c是一个c版本的搜索引擎,是基于APR库开发的。

# 用户目标 Developers
# 操作系统 All 32-bit /64-bit MS Windows (95/98/NT/2000/XP), All POSIX (Linux/BSD/UNIX-like OSes), OS Independent (Written in an interpreted language), Linux
# 编程语言 C

由于搜索引擎是长期不间断运行,对性能和稳定性要求很高,属于服务器程序,因此Apache官方开始用APR开发搜索引擎,并把APR应用到搜索界人人皆知的Lucene中。


我们不只是拿Lucene4c来说事啊,也许很多C/C++朋友不知道这个Lucene4c,也不知道Lucene。那么,大家总该知道,那个apache web服务器,目前几乎一统web服务器天下了吧『不知道的就打自己一个耳光:)』。它就是基于APR库开发的。

强啊,呵呵!

教你怎样成为C++高手

1.把C++当成一门新的语言学习(和C没啥关系!真的。); 2.看《Thinking In C++》,不要看《C++变成死相》(C++编程思想,翻译的非常差); 3.看《The C++ Program...
  • hellokandy
  • hellokandy
  • 2016年10月24日 11:07
  • 481

编程高手无捷径

想成为编程高手,想必是每个程序员的愿望。当你发现某个角落冒出个大牛时,除了深深的膜拜,只好自叹不如啊。话说1个优秀程序员能顶10个普通程序员,这让你更想成为人人敬仰的高手了。编程高手犹如武林高手一般,...
  • booirror
  • booirror
  • 2013年12月01日 13:37
  • 5450

使用Sublime Text 2编译运行C/C++程序

Windows 7 下使用Sublime Text 2 & mingw运行C/C++程序。
  • cengqiao
  • cengqiao
  • 2015年11月13日 19:21
  • 467

【排序算法】选择排序(C++实现)

选择排序算法就是每一趟从待排序的记录中选出关键字最小(最大)的记录,顺序放在已排好序的子文件的最后(最前),直到全部记录排序完毕。常见的选择排序有直接选择排序(Selection Sort),堆排序(...
  • left_la
  • left_la
  • 2013年03月10日 16:01
  • 15362

新手必看:如何成为一个很牛的C++程序员

这个题目的噱头太大,要真的写起来, 足够写一本书了。本人是过来人, 结合自身的体会和大家交流一下,希望新人能少走弯路。每个人的情况不一样,我下面的描述可能并不适合每一个看到这篇文章的人。 一、C...
  • encoder1234
  • encoder1234
  • 2013年09月18日 15:47
  • 2180

C++文件(夹)选择对话框

由于各种应用,我们需要调用系统的打开文件对话框或者打开文件夹对话框,或两者兼有。今遇到这个情况已经解决,特写下这篇博文。 1.打开文件对话框常用的方法是使用系统的CFileDialog。这里介绍另外...
  • xdrt81y
  • xdrt81y
  • 2013年11月06日 12:05
  • 22167

传智播客C语言视频第一季(有效下载期为10.1-10.7,10.8关闭)

J:\传智播客_尹成_C语言从菜鸟到高手├─传智播客_尹成_C语言从菜鸟到高手_第一章C语言概述A│      第一讲1.1C语言第一阶段.mp4│      第二讲1.2c语言入门教程.mp4│  ...
  • yincheng01
  • yincheng01
  • 2014年10月03日 15:50
  • 9716

成为java高手的八大条件

成为java高手的八大条件
  • javaniuniu
  • javaniuniu
  • 2016年07月16日 13:56
  • 1067

Matlab代码迁移至C++(上)

一、背景 用MATLAB的强大神器——Coder将MATLAB代码转移到C++
  • lijiayu2015
  • lijiayu2015
  • 2016年12月02日 22:45
  • 2336

成为高手的必经之路——学会调试代码(菜鸟必读)

任何一个编程者都少不了要去调试代码,不管你是高手还是菜鸟,调试程序都是一项必不可少的工作。一般来说调试程序是在编写代码之后或测试期修改Bug 时进行的,往往在调试代码期间更加能够体现出编程者的水平高低...
  • yhzhang1016
  • yhzhang1016
  • 2014年01月15日 11:10
  • 816
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:C/C++高手的选择 (2)
举报原因:
原因补充:

(最多只允许输入30个字)